Analysis
Ecuador recorded 0.4175 kt for agrifood systems waste disposal — emissions in 2023.
The figure is up 0.8% on the previous year and up 22.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, agrifood systems waste disposal — emissions in Ecuador peaked at 0.418 kt in 2020 and was at its lowest, 0.1788 kt, in 1990.
Ecuador ranks 76th of 205 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 34 years of available data.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ions Totals summarizes the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ions disseminated in the FAOSTAT Climate Change domains of emissions from agrifood systems. Data are computed following the Tier 1 methods of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 1996; 1997; 2000; 2002; 2006; 2014). Emissions from other economic sectors as defined by the IPCC are also disseminated in the domain for completeness.
